IL-1ß promotes IL-17A production of ILC3s to aggravate neutrophilic airway inflammation in mice.
Yang, Dan; Li, Yi'na; Liu, Ting; Yang, Ling; He, Lixiu; Huang, Tingxuan; Zhang, Lanlan; Luo, Jian; Liu, Chuntao.
